| Abstract | The reaction of P4S10 (1) with N,N 0 -diphenylurea (PhNH)2CO (2) results in new heterocyclic compounds: the pyridinium salt of 1,3-diphenyl-2-sulfido-2-thioxo-1,3-diaza-2k 5 -phosphetidine (3) (with a P–N–C–N cycle) and the pyridinium salt of 1,4-diphenyl-2,5disulfido-2,5-dithioxo-1,4-dithiadiaza-2k 5 ,5k 5 -diphosphinane (4), containing the (P–S–N)2 cycle and the cyclic thiophosphates [pyH]2[P2S8 ]( 5), [pyH]2[P2S7 ]( 6) and [pyH]3[P3S9 ]( 7). A similar reaction, but carried out with N,N 0 -diphenylthiourea (PhNH)2CS (8), leads to the formation of 4 and 6. pyPS2Cl (9), used as an alternative starting material, also yields compounds 3, 4, 5, and further [pyH][PS2Cl2 ]( 10) and S8 after reaction with 2. Compound 3 reacts with Pd(CH3COO)2, with the formation of the complex [Pd(Ph2N2COPS2)2 ]( 11). The crystal structures of 3 and 7 were determined by single-crystal X-ray diffraction. � 2007 Elsevier Ltd. All rights reserved. |
